Job Description
You will be part of a dedicated AML & KYC function, playing a key role in onboarding clients and investors while ensuring ongoing monitoring of these relationships. You will work closely with internal teams and clients to deliver high-quality compliance support, ensuring adherence to AML/CFT regulations while maintaining strong service standards.
What you’ll do
- You will perform AML/KYC processes including onboarding, periodic reviews, and investor due diligence in line with regulatory requirements and internal timelines
- You will complete key controls such as name screening, risk assessments, and source of wealth/funds verification, ensuring all documentation is accurate and up to date
- You will act as a key point of contact for clients and stakeholders, collecting due diligence documentation and providing timely responses to queries
- You will ensure timely and high-quality delivery of client CDD, periodic reviews, investor KYC, and overnight screening activities
- You will prepare management reports, track key metrics, and escalate risks, breaches, or issues to relevant stakeholders where required
- You will support team operations by guiding junior members, maintaining process adherence, and contributing to continuous improvement and compliance standards
